Output 8e74d791465f5c93a476cac9cc08f1d8c94b571da2ed32bd193384896ed31480:1

value
180325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b013a135a950da70b9b840a123fc00abc2f1300 OP_EQUAL
address
3QaCzwHXgByLBrktSubJ6EBcuk15VHjL5L
transaction
8e74d791465f5c93a476cac9cc08f1d8c94b571da2ed32bd193384896ed31480
spent
true